Estos contenidos se han traducido de forma automática para su comodidad, pero Huawei Cloud no garantiza la exactitud de estos. Para consultar los contenidos originales, acceda a la versión en inglés.
Centro de ayuda/ MapReduce Service/ Preguntas frecuentes/ Descripción de MRS/ ¿Cuál es la relación entre Kudu y HBase?
Actualización más reciente 2023-11-20 GMT+08:00

¿Cuál es la relación entre Kudu y HBase?

Kudu está diseñado basándose en la estructura de HBase y puede implementar funciones rápidas de lectura/escritura aleatoria y actualización que HBase hace bien. Kudu y HBase son similares en arquitectura. A continuación, se detallan las diferencias:

  • HBase utiliza ZooKeeper para garantizar la consistencia de los datos, mientras que Kudu utiliza el algoritmo de consenso de Raft para garantizar la consistencia.
  • HBase utiliza HDFS para el almacenamiento de datos resistente, mientras que Kudu utiliza TServer para garantizar una sólida consistencia y confiabilidad de los datos.